Forecast: Import of Knitted or Crocheted Men's and Boys' Trousers and Shorts of Synthetic Fibres to the UK

Based on the forecasted data for the import of knitted or crocheted men's and boys' trousers and shorts of synthetic fibres to the UK, there is a consistent upward trend from 2024 to 2028, with values rising from 39.504 to 43.763 million. Regrettably, actual data for 2023 is unavailable, preventing direct comparison. Year-on-year growth rates are projected to hover around 2-3%, depicting a steady increase in import value.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for this period is approximately 2.5%.

Future trends to watch include:

  • Potential impacts of Brexit-related trade adjustments.
  • Shifts in consumer preferences towards sustainable and eco-friendly synthetic fibers.
  • Economic factors, such as inflation and currency exchange rates, affecting import costs.
  • Technological innovations in textile manufacturing and design influencing market dynamics.
